An 8∼20GHz wideband frequency synthesizer

This paper describes an 8∼20GHz wideband, low spurs and low phase frequency synthesizer module with 10MHz step size, based on PLL (Phase-Locked Loop) and direct analog synthesizer technology. The module consists of five parts: the frequency multiplier, PLL1, PLL2, and two switch of filter bank. The experimental measurement of the actual module shows that the spurious are less than −55dBc and the phase noise is about −90dBc/Hz at 1kHz offset. In addition, the output power level flatness is 13.5dBm±3.5dBm.
